Alaska Airlines flies internationally, but its network is mostly regional rather than long-haul. Their international routes focus on nearby destinations in Canada, Mexico, Belize, and Costa Rica. From West Coast cities like Seattle, Los Angeles, and Portland, you’ll find multiple options to popular vacation spots, especially in Mexico. Service to Belize and Costa Rica is seasonal in some cases, so it’s worth checking specific travel dates. They don’t operate their own flights to Europe or Asia, but travelers can reach those regions through Alaska’s partner airlines. Overall, their international service centers on North and Central America.
